Are people in Sullivan older or younger than people in Belfast?- The Median Age in Sullivan is 18.2 years younger than in Belfast.
Are housing costs cheaper in Sullivan or Belfast?- Sullivan
housing costs are 8.9% less expensive than Belfast hous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Sullivan or Belfast?- The average commute for residents of Sullivan is 7.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Belfast.
